Q: What does the RA 632-052-101-A designation indicate?
A: The RA 632-052-101-A is a Raymond load wheel with a 95A durometer polyurethane compound. The -A suffix identifies this specific durometer grade within the 632-052-101 product family.
Q: Is there a higher durometer version available?
A: Yes. The RA 632-052-101-XL offers 97A durometer polyurethane for applications requiring extended tread life. Consult our parts team to confirm dimensional compatibility before switching between durometer grades.
Q: Which Raymond equipment models use this wheel?
A: The 632-052-101-A is referenced for Raymond 7400 Reach Pallet Trucks. Verify your specific equipment model and serial range against your reach truck manual before ordering to ensure proper fitment.

Q: What is the difference between the 95A and 97A durometer versions?
A: The 97A durometer (RA 632-052-101-XL) is slightly harder and typically offers longer tread life for high-traffic applications, while 95A provides a balance of grip and durability. The choice depends on your floor conditions and usage intensity.
